The door has to work properly every time it is used. What local weather does to garage doors New England weather does not give mechanical systems much of a break. Cold snaps, humidity, snow, road salt, and freeze-thaw cycles all take their toll. Burlington sees enough seasonal variation to expose weak points in garage door components. Springs can lose tension. Metal parts corrode. Rollers wear unevenly. Even a door that looked fine in autumn can behave very differently in winter. That is one reason garage door spring repair comes up so often in service conversations. Springs do the heavy lifting. They counterbalance the door so that the opener does not carry the entire load. When a spring weakens or breaks, the door may slam shut, refuse to open fully, or feel unusually heavy. That is more than an inconvenience. It can be a safety issue, especially if someone tries to force the door manually. Garage door roller repair is another common need in towns like Burlington, especially where temperatures swing sharply through the year. Rollers that run smoothly in mild weather can become noisy or sticky when dirt, moisture, and wear accumulate. A homeowner might first notice the sound, a sharp rattle or squeal, long before the door actually jams. That noise is often an early warning that the system needs attention. Garage door panel repair matters too, especially after a vehicle bump, storm damage, or years of repeated stress. A dented panel can throw off the door’s balance and appearance at the same time. In some cases the damage is mostly cosmetic. In others, a warped panel affects alignment and movement. A seasoned technician looks at both the visual damage and the mechanical consequences before recommending a fix. Why garage doors deserve more attention than they get Most people do not think about a garage door until it starts behaving badly. It sticks halfway, shudders when opening, or makes a noise that sounds far more expensive than it should. But the garage door is one of the hardest-working moving systems on a property. It opens and closes thousands of times over the years. It takes weather, vibration, and impact in a way that few other residential components do. In Burlington, that wear adds up quickly. Salted winter roads, freeze-thaw cycles, and constant use all affect hardware. A door that looked fine in October can show its age by March. That is why Garage Door Repair is such a practical concern here. It is not only about convenience, though that matters. It is also about security, energy efficiency, and avoiding larger failures. A damaged panel is a good example. Some people assume a dented or bent panel is merely cosmetic, especially if the door still opens. In practice, a damaged panel can throw off alignment, strain the opener, and compromise insulation. If a section is warped enough, it may create uneven movement that wears out rollers and tracks faster. Garage Door Panel Repair becomes a smart intervention when the door structure is still sound enough to save. It is often the difference between a targeted fix and a full replacement. When panel repair is the right move Not every damaged door needs to be replaced. That is one of the first things an experienced technician looks at carefully. If the damage is isolated to one section, and the door’s frame, track, springs, and opener are functioning well, Garage Door Panel Repair can restore performance without forcing the homeowner into a larger expense. There are trade-offs, though. A panel repair is most effective when the replacement section can be matched reasonably well, and when the damage has not spread to the door’s structure. If the door has multiple dented panels, cracked sections, or significant alignment issues, repair may only delay a bigger fix. Good judgment matters here. The cheapest option is not always the smartest one, and the most expensive option is not always necessary. This is also where overhead doors require a slightly different lens. Overhead Garage Door Repair often involves evaluating not just the visible surface, but the balance of the entire system. If the door is heavy, misaligned, or operating under tension that has changed over time, a surface-level fix will not solve the underlying issue. The same is true if the opener seems to struggle because the door itself is binding. The visible problem may be the panel, but the hidden problem may be a spring, roller, or track issue. Springs, rollers, and the sound of a door going wrong A well-maintained garage door should not sound angry. Some noise is normal, especially in older systems, but grinding, snapping, or jerking motion points to trouble. Garage Door Spring Repair is one of the most critical services in that category. Springs carry enormous tension and do much of the lifting work. When they weaken or fail, the door becomes unsafe to operate and can become effectively unusable. Rollers matter too. Garage Door Roller Repair is often overlooked because rollers are small and inexpensive compared with springs or openers. Yet worn rollers can create Electra Overhead Doors Garage Door Spring Repair vibration, noisy movement, and unnecessary strain across the whole assembly. Replacing damaged rollers at the right time can extend the life of the door and reduce wear on tracks and hinges. A technician with real field experience usually looks for patterns rather than isolated symptoms. One panel with impact damage might be simple. A panel plus a sagging track plus noisy rollers tells a more complicated story. That is the kind of diagnostic thinking that saves property owners from repeating the same repair in three months. Signs it is time to call a professional Some garage door problems are obvious. Others announce themselves subtly, then get worse. The most useful habit is to pay attention to changes, not just failures. A door that used to close smoothly but now pauses halfway deserves attention before it stops altogether. The clearest warning signs usually include a visible panel bend, uneven travel, a door that feels heavier than before, loud scraping, or a spring that appears damaged or loose. If the opener is working harder than usual, that can be a clue too. The garage door system is integrated, so one weak component often creates a chain reaction. People sometimes try to treat these problems as weekend projects. For minor maintenance, that may be fine. For springs, structural damage, or stuck doors, it is not worth improvising. A garage door stores enough energy to cause injury if handled poorly. Professional repair is not just about getting the door moving again. It is about doing so safely and in a way that preserves the rest of the system.
